Cordic sine and cosine
This is the most clicked, popular link in google for vhdl implementation of cordic algorithm to generate sine and cosine wave## at present time, many. The most basic way of using a cordic is to combine it with a phase accumulator and generate sine and cosine waves for use in i and q. The cordic approach is to replace the cosine portion of this rotation matrix with a 1 , and the sine portion with a 2^-k.
This paper presents the theoretical basis and practical implementation of circular (sine-cosine) cordic-based generator synthesis results of. For example, to evaluate sin(48), what math process could i use if i didn't have a calculator they use an algorithm called the cordic algorithm calculation is used to find the other trig functions, particularly the cosine. This example shows how to compute sine and cosine using a cordic rotation kernel in matlab.
Or cordic for the calculation of trigonometric functions, multiplication, division several algorithms are proposed for calculation of sine and cosine function. Generation of sine and cosine values has been implemented and verified using simulink keywords: cordic, simulink, pipeline architecture, shift and add,. The coordinate rotation digital computer (cordic) has established its popularity in several important areas of application, like generation of sine and cosine. Introduction ▫ cordic (coordinate rotation digital computer) ▫ introduced in 1959 by jack e volder ▫ efficient to compute sin, cos, tan, sinh, cosh, tanh.
Cordic-sincosbpe given an angle in degrees, 0-360, calculates the sine and cosine to xxxx cordic is an acronym for coordinate rotation digital. Abstract: the aim of this paper is to investigate cordic schemes for fast and silicon area efficient computation of the sine and cosine functions that are suitable. The cordic architecture is modeled by using the verilog hdl and verified with matlab to get the values of sine or cosine, the most common methods are. Other angles can be handled by adding a factor π first (modulo 2π ) and changing the sign of the sine and cosine result the floating point. Hardware efficient architecture by using cordic algorithm for the calculation of sine and cosine functions this approach is simulated using modelsim.
Cordic (coordinate rotation digital computer) is a method for sine and cosine can be calculated using the first cordic scheme which. Calculators either use the taylor series for sin / cos or the cordic algorithm a lot of information is available on taylor series, so i'll explain cordic instead. Modelsim is used to view sine wave keywords coordinate rotation digital computer(cordic)cosine/sine fpga, recursive architecture i introduction. Sine and cosine of an angle using cordic algorithm (coordinate rotation digital computer), a simple and efficient algorithm to calculate hyperbolic and. Below is an excerpt from a paper by the late rick parris (phillips exeter academy ) found at i haven't tried it by.
Cordic sine and cosine
Cordic can also be used to calculate other math functions like sin and cos let's say you have the coordinates (x, y) of a point and you want to calculate the . The cordic components provide both rotation or vectoring mode based on a when calculating sin and cos, the output is constrained to the range +/-10. Abstract: digital modalities of sine and cosine waves are gaining enormous attention in the coordinate rotation digital computer (cordic) algorithm has. For developing hardware implementation solution in short time with optimized hardware resources keywords: cordic, sine, cosine, xsg, fpga, vhdl xilinx.
- First, the taylor series is not the best/fastest way to implement sine/cos here is a well documented cordic implementation in c cordic implementations,.
- Cordic also known as volder's algorithm, is a simple and efficient algorithm to calculate his research led to an internal technical report proposing the cordic algorithm to solve sine and cosine functions and a prototypical computer.
Keywords: coordinate rotation digital computer (cordic), cosine/sine, fpga, important areas of application like generation of sine and cosine functions. Square root division sine, cosine, and their inverses tangent and its inverse as well as hyperbolic sine and its inverse these functions are implemented by. Abstract: objective of this paper is to generate sine and cosine function using cordic algorithm cordic comes fast when to evaluate dsp algorithms uses.